2022 trocken Rosé, Franconia/Franken, Germany

Somewhat tart, vegetal to herbaceous, nutty and a hint of smoky aroma with stone fruit notes and a hint of mixed berries. Clear, juicy, delicately sweetish fruit with nuances reminiscent of cassis and mint, fine acidity, delicate tannic grip, blanched almonds and paprika in the background, certain persistence, salty and chalky tones, good, again juicy finish.
